Dr. Anna M. Pou earned her medical degree from Louisiana State University School of Medicine in New Orleans. She completed her residency training in general surgery at the University of Tennessee Health Sciences Center in Memphis followed by residency training in otolaryngology-head and neck surgery at the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ine. Dr. Pou completed her fellowship in head and neck surgery and microvascular reconstruction at the Methodist Hospital of Indiana, Indiana University in Indianapolis.

Dr. Pou is a board-certified diplomate of the American Board of Otolaryngology and a fellow of the American College of Surgeons. She is a member of the American Academy of Otolaryngology-Head and Neck Surgery, the American Head and Neck Society and the Society of University Otolaryngologists. Her clinical interests include the treatment of patients with cancer of the head and neck, including skin cancer, endocrine tumors and the rehabilitation of the head and neck cancer patient.
